Jonesville is a small town located in Catahoula Parish, in the state of Louisiana. With a population of just over 2,000 people, it is a close-knit community that is known for its Southern charm and hospitality. The town is situated along the banks of the Ouachita River, offering beautiful views and a serene atmosphere.

Jonesville has a rich history that dates back to the early 1800s when the area was first settled by European immigrants. The town has played an important role in the state’s history, particularly during the Civil War, when it served as a strategic location for both Union and Confederate forces. Today, visitors can learn about the town’s history at the Catahoula Parish Museum, which features exhibits on the area’s early settlers, the Civil War, and local industry.

The town is known for its outdoor recreational opportunities, with the nearby Ouachita River providing ample opportunities for fishing, boating, and water sports. The surrounding countryside is also popular for hunting and hiking, and the nearby Catahoula National Wildlife Refuge offers a chance to see a variety of native wildlife in their natural habitat.

Jonesville also hosts a number of annual events and festivals that celebrate the town’s culture and heritage. The Catahoula Corners Festival, held each spring, features live music, food vendors, and arts and crafts, while the Jonesville Christmas Parade is a beloved holiday tradition for residents and visitors alike.
